The first law of thermodynamics is simply the case of – (1) Charles law (2) Newton's law of cooling (3) The law of heat exchange (4) The law of conservation of energy
(4) The law of conservation of energy Explanation: The first law of thennodynamics is a version of the law of conservation of energy for thermodynamic systems. It states That the change in the internal energy of a system is equal to the heat added to the system plus the work done on the system.
